Transaction 2e91c0a5c362e90f4df695a0344fc2c5e29cb20047929a58d10cdfc48be11083
1 Input
1 Output
-
2e91c0a5c362e90f4df695a0344fc2c5e29cb20047929a58d10cdfc48be11083:0
- value
- 30024610
- script pubkey
- OP_0 OP_PUSHBYTES_20 8be2cf9d5fe694a382728df88893ee8f7d15dffa
- address
- bc1q303vl82lu6228qnj3hug3ylw3a73thl6mxmneu